Output 63bc90dc616d3b2fbbe9b4018fe0d21c8d5776ea7b2ec35702ea704549a96085:2

value
89980000
script pubkey
OP_0 OP_PUSHBYTES_20 f0998b2885b4a58930b4bfb5ced4ab10661a783a
address
bc1q7zvck2y9kjjcjv95h76ua49tzpnp57p6wtfyyp
transaction
63bc90dc616d3b2fbbe9b4018fe0d21c8d5776ea7b2ec35702ea704549a96085
confirmations
168535
spent
true